**Alert: CRON_DRIFT_HIGH — Tallowmere batch cluster**

This alert fires when scheduled jobs on the Tallowmere cluster start more than 90 seconds after their cron expression, sustained over three consecutive windows. Common causes include NTP sync failures on the scheduler node or queue saturation from long-running predecessors. Do not restart the scheduler before capturing drift metrics. The full investigation procedure is documented on the internal page.

runbook for tafof-yawif: https://confluence.tolvaqsys.internal/display/display/browse/pages/7be3

MEMO — Kettling Depot Receiving

Uniform sets for the new Kettling depot arrive Wednesday via Ashgrove courier: 40 boxes, sorted by size, manifest attached to box one. Check the count at the dock before signing; shortages go straight to stores, not the courier. The hand-over instruction the courier will follow is set out below.

drop instructions, tafof-baguf: the holmir gilox courier leaves the sormir ulaok holdor ledger at gate 5596 under passcode 257343

## Runbook: Fan-out Backpressure on Heraldix

When the Heraldix notification service falls behind, the fan-out workers shed load by pausing low-priority topics first. Support should confirm the queue depth gauge before escalating, since brief spikes self-resolve. If sustained beyond ten minutes, restart workers with the backpressure settings shown below.

service settings:
[oliix]
team = noveth
access_code = ac_4de949
host = oliix.novachq.corp
port = 8080
owner = wenir.casion
peer = wenys.lumicstack.corp

RUNBOOK — Recalled Chargers, Pallet Return

Heads up: the pallet of recalled Voltbrook chargers is shrink-wrapped and flagged with red recall tape in bay 6. It goes back to the Fennick returns hub, not the usual distribution route — don't let autorouting grab it. One pallet only, no splitting, and the driver signs the recall manifest at both ends. Schedule it on the morning run so Fennick books it same day. Courier hand-over goes as follows.

handover note for yagef-bagep: the drudor pelius courier leaves the kasdor zorvan norir ledger at gate 8016 under passcode 755406